Burnley defender Hjamlar Ekdal was stretchered off during Sweden’s 2-1 defeat against Denmark.

Ekdal came on for the second half and had only been on the pitch for several minutes when he suffered a hamstring injury.

Sweden went on to lose the game 2-1, with Manchester United midfielder Christian Eriksen scoring a late winner.

Tottenham man Pierre-Emile Hojbjerg had netted an early opener but it was quickly cancelled out by Newcastle forward Alexander Isak.

After the final whistle, manager Jon Dahl Tomasson told the press: “He suffered pain in his hamstring after a run, which made continuing to play impossible.

"We will do further investigations tomorrow, after which we will probably know more.

“I am extremely disappointed when players break up because I know how much he wants to play for Sweden.

“He was extremely disappointed. I was also very disappointed for him because he has trained very well.

“He comes from a tough spell at Burnley, where the last game he played was against Brighton. He hasn't played much this season so it's disappointing for Hjalmar.”

Ekdal arrived at Turf Moor from Djurgarden in January 2023 and made nine appearances last season as the Clarets were relegated from the Premier League.

It was the 25-year-old’s seventh senior cap in the international stage, having made his debut in 2022.
